Abstract

The invention discloses an intelligent waste bin which comprises an outer barrel and an inner barrel which sleeves inside the outer barrel. A cavity exists between the outer barrel and the inner barrel; the intelligent waste bin further comprises a remote control car with a remote controller, an infrared sensor, a prompter and a processing unit; the waste bin is fixedly connected to the upper end of the remote control car, so that the waste bin can walk under remote control; the infrared sensor can sense whether the waste are full of the waste bin; the processing unit controls the prompter to send out an alarm so as to remind a user that the waste bin is full, so that the environmental health can be kept; the intelligent waste bin further comprises a solar cell panel which provides electric energy to the processing unit. Therefore, the intelligent waste bin is environment-friendly and economic.

Description

technical field [0001] The invention mainly relates to a garbage can, in particular to an intelligent garbage can. Background technique [0002] Trash cans are the most commonly used daily necessities in people's daily life. Ordinary trash cans have a single function, are unhygienic and inconvenient, and bacteria are easy to breed if they are not dumped in time, which is harmful to human health. Ordinary trash cans cannot move automatically and are inconvenient to move. It is very inconvenient for people to use it, and they need to walk over to put out the garbage. A garbage can that can control the walking of the garbage can by remote control and can prompt in time when to clean up the garbage is a direction that needs to be studied urgently at present.
